Mondatoo raises in mid position
Kinboshi peels in the cut off. This being the new Kinboshi who wants to play hands
Sedan Turker shoves in the big blind
Monda reshoves
Kinboshi passes
Turker 9-9
Monda J-J
Jacks hold, Monda over 220,000. Turker out
Blinds are 1-2k/200. 74 left 27 paid
